University of Toledo is located in Toledo, oh.
The acceptance rate for University of Toledo is 92%.
The average high school GPA for University of Toledo students was 3.56.
The estimated cost for 4 years at University of Toledo including tuition, room and board, and books and other fees is $123,172.
